History of Ready-to-Assemble Furniture

Ready-to-assemble furniture, also known as flat-pack or knock-down furniture, emerged in the mid-20th century. Initially, it was designed to offer a cost-effective solution for furnishing homes. Over the years, the RTA format has evolved, incorporating advanced materials and innovative designs. But what has driven this evolution?

Benefits of Ready-to-Assemble Furniture

The ready-to-assemble format offers numerous advantages:

  • Affordability: RTA furniture is generally more cost-effective than pre-assembled pieces.
  • Convenience: Easy to transport and store, making it ideal for urban dwellers.
  • Customization: Many RTA products offer customizable options to suit individual tastes.

Moreover, the environmental impact is reduced due to efficient packaging and shipping methods. Have you ever wondered how much space is saved during transportation?

Challenges and Solutions

Despite its benefits, the ready-to-assemble format does come with challenges. Assembly can be time-consuming and sometimes frustrating. However, manufacturers are continually improving instructions and providing online tutorials to ease the process. Future Trends in Ready-to-Assemble Furniture

The future of RTA furniture looks promising, with trends leaning towards sustainability and smart design. Innovations such as tool-free assembly and modular designs are gaining traction. Additionally, the integration of technology, like augmented reality for assembly instructions, is set to enhance the user experience.
